Title: Nathan J Withers: Innovator in Scintillator Nanomaterials
Introduction
Nathan J Withers is a prominent inventor based in Albuquerque, NM (US). He has made significant contributions to the field of nanomaterials, particularly in the development of scintillator materials. With a total of 6 patents to his name, his work has implications for various applications, including radiation detection.
Latest Patents
One of Nathan's latest patents involves a halide-based scintillator nanomaterial. This invention features a heterogeneous scintillator material comprising core/shell nanoparticles. The core consists of a highly hygroscopic or deliquescent halide-based material activated with trivalent or divalent lanthanide ions. The stable non-hygroscopic shell enhances the performance of these nanoparticles. Another notable patent focuses on thermal neutron detectors that utilize gadolinium-containing nanoscintillators. This method detects thermal neutron radiation by observing scintillation events from the nanoscintillators.
